Anda di halaman 1dari 40

BAHAN AJAR MAPEL TEKNOLOGI LAYANAN JARINGAN KELAS XII TKJ

TUTORIAL INSTALASI DAN KONFIGURASI SERVER VoIP


Voice over Internet Protocol

Dibuat Oleh :
Atan Fises Barus
SMK Negeri 1 Percut Sei Tuan
Tutorial ini dibuat mencakup beberapa Kompetensi Dasar
dari mata pelajaran Teknologi Layanan Jaringan kelas XII
Jurusan TKJ diantaranya :

I. Kompetensi Dasar :

3.11.Menerapkan prosedur instalasi Serversoftswitch berbasis session initial protocol (SIP)

4.11 Menginstalasi Server Softswitch berbasis session initial protocol

Indikator :

3.11.1.Menjelaskan session initial protocol

3.11.2.Menentukan cara instalasi session initial protocol

4.11.1 Menginstalasi Server softswitch berbasis session initial protocol (ISP)

Tujuan Pembelajaran

-Setelah mengkaji dari berbagai literatur, peserta didik mampu Menjelaskan session initial protocol

-Setelah mengkaji dari berbagai literatur, peserta didik mampu Menentukan cara instalasi session initial protocol

-Setelah kegiatan pembelajaran diharapkan peserta didik dapat mengkonfigurasi instalasi session initial protocol
dengan benar

-Setelah kegiatan pembelajaran diharapkan peserta didik dapat memodifikasi server softswitch berbasis session
initial protocol (SIP) dengan benar
II. Kompetensi Dasar :
 3.12.Memahami konfigurasi ekstensi dan dial-plan Server softswitch
 3.12 Menyajikan hasil Konfigurasi ekstensi dan dial plan server softswitch
Indikator :
 4.12.1 Menjelaskan konfigurasi ekstensi dan dial-plan server softswitch
 4.12.1 Mempresentasikan hasil konfigurasi ekstensi dan dial-plan server
softswitch
 
Tujuan Pembelajaran
 Setelah mengkaji dari berbagai literatur, peserta didik mampu Menjelaskan
konfigurasi ekstensi dan dial-plan server softswitch
 Setelah Kegiatan pembelajaran diharapkan peserta didik dapat menerapkan
konfigurasi ektensi dan dial-plan server softswitch dengan tepat
 Setelah kegiatan pembelajaran diharapkan peserta didik dapat memodifikasi
konfigurasi ekstensi dan dial-plan server softswitch dengan benar
III. Komptensi Dasar :
 3.13. Memahami fungsi firewall pada jaringan VoIP
 4.13 Menalar Fungsi firewall pada jaringan VoIP
Indikator :
 3.13.1. Menjelaskan fungsi firewall pada VoIP
 3.13.2. Menentukan cara konfigurasi firewall pada VoIP
 
 Tujuan Pembelajaran
 Setelah mengkaji dari berbagai literatur, peserta didik mampu memahami
fungsi firewall pada VoIP
 Setelah mengkaji dari berbagai literatur, peserta didik mampu Menjelaskan
fungsi firewall pada VoIP
 Setelah mengkaji dari berbagai literatur, peserta didik mampu Menentukan cara
konfigurasi firewall pada VoIP
PENGHANTAR MATERI
Voice over Internet Protocol (VoIP)
”VoIP:

Proses percakapan suara jarak jauh melalui media internet.


Data suara diubah menjadi kode digital dan dialirkan
melalui jaringan yang mengirimkan paket-paket data
(diunduh dari Wikipedia).
Bukan lewat sirkuit analog telephone biasa
Voice over Internet Protocol (VoIP) merupakan teknologi
yang memanfaatkan Internet protocoluntuk menyediakan
komunikasi voice suara secara elektronis dan real-time
(Anton R. Raharjo.2006)
 VoIPdapat dioperasikan melalui jaringan
komputer selayaknyatelepon pada Public Switched
Telephone Network (PSTN) namun yang
membedakan adalah VoIP dapat menggunakan
softphone pada komputer untuk dapat
berkomunikasi tanpa menggunakan perangkat
telepon analog.
Komponen VoIP

 Server VoIP
 Komputer client lengkap dengan sound card,
headset lengkap dengan microfon dan speaker NIC
 Hub/Scitch
 Media penghubung , contoh : jaringan LAN
Skema sederhana jaringan VoIP
 Perbedaan VoIP dengan telepon tradisional
adalah masalah infrastrukturnya,jika VoIP
menggunakan jaringan komputer sedangkan
telepon tradisional menggunakan
infrastruktur telepon yaang sudah dibangun
lebih awal.
Perbandingan spesifikasi VoIP dan PSTN
Komponen yang membangun tahapan
perintah extention atau command line
 Context adalah kumpulan dari beberapa instruksi eksekusi pada dial plan
yangmempunyai beragam kegunaan.fungsi context adalah membedakan
interaksidial plan dari satu grup dengan grup yang lain.sebuah ekstensi yang
berada di dalam satu context akan terisolasi terhadapekstensi lainnya.semua
intruksi yang terletak di bawah sebuah context di definisikan sebagaibagian
dari context tersebut sampai didapatkan context berikutnya.contoh:
[lab01]exsten -> 103,1,Answer ()exsten -> 103,n,PlayBack (selamat
datang)exsten -> 103,n,BackGround (masukkan_no_eks)exsten ->
103,n,Waitexsten ()context adalah nama grup ekstensi dimana ekstensi yang
telah didefinisikanpada satu contoh akan terisolasi dari ekstensi yang berada
pada contextlain.dan context dibuat dengan cara menuliskan nama di dalam
kurung ([]).serta nama dari context boleh terdiri dari huruf A-Z serta angka
dari 0-9.
 Exstension adalah sekumpulan perintah untuk di jalankan berdasarkan
urutandari tingkat prioritasnya.
 Priority merupakan urutan dari perintah yang harus di jalankan dalamsebuah
exstension.biasanya berupa angka integer.perintah pertamayang akan
di jalankan harus dimulai dengan prioritas satu,kemudian asterisk akan
menambah ke prioritas dua dan seterusnya.
 Command adalah perintah atau “aplikasi”yang dijalankan oleh astrisk.
 Parameter adalah ukuran dari seluruh populasi,namun tidak semua
command/perintah membutuhkan parameterdiantaranya:
user –user id untuk SIP server ( contoh 2345 )
authuser -authorization user (optional) untuk SIPserver.
secret -user password
host -nama server
port -port SIP di server.default 5060
exstension -nomor exstension lokal di asterisk
 Dial Plan berfungsi sebagai routing panggilan antar ekstensi,baik yang ada dalam
satuIP-PBX (lokal)maupun antar IP-PBX biasa di sebut trunk.dalam asterisk
dial plan di program dalam satu file
yang bernama exstensions,conf.secara umum setiap ekstensi dalam asterisk
merujuk pada user tertentu yang terregister keasterisk tersebut sehingga
biasanya nomber ekstensi sama dengan id user.
 Cara kerja softwitch
softwitch adalah suatu alat yang mampu menghubungkan antar jaringan sirkut
dengan jaringan paket,termasuk di dalam jaringan telepon tetap (PSTN),internet
yang berbasis IP, kabel TV, dan jaringan seluler. bagian-bagian softwich
:-perangkat keras (hardware) yang biasa di sebut media gateway (MG)-perangkat
lunak (software) yang biasa disebut media gateway controller(MGC) yang fokus
pada software call-processing.cara kerja softwich :MSG akan bekerja di tataran
penganturan panggilannya (call control) sertacall proccessing,kemudian akan
mengontrol panggilan yang masuk untukmengetahui jenis media panggilan dan
tujuannya.dari siti MSG akanmengirimkan sinyal ke MG untuk melakukan koneksi
baik intrakoneksi jaringan sirkuit ke sirkuit paket atau sebaliknya.MSG dan MG
akan saling berhubungan dengan protocol megacho (MGCP).untuk jaringan sirkuit
. MSGakan mengirimkan SS7 (signal system 7).sementara jika berhubungan
dengan jaringan paket,maka MSG akan menggunakan H,323 atau SIP
TUTORIAL INSTALASI DAN KONFIGURASI SERVER VoIP
SECARA VIRTUAL MENGUNAKAN VIRTUAL BOX

Alat dan Bahan:


 Laptop / Komputer
 Software pendukung :
Virtual Box (media untuk melakukan instalasi secara virtual)
Softswitch Trixbox (Operating Sistem berupa file “.iso”,
Softphone X-Lite (Software yang digunakan untuk melakukan percobaan
panggilan suara dan video)
OS Win XP-SP2 (Operating Sistem sebagai client di Virtual box berupa
file “.iso”).
Software Perekam OBS Studio ( Atau boleh menggunakan software lain)
 Internet
TAHAPAN INSTALLASI TRIXBOX

Tampilan pertama yang muncul ketika installasi Trixbox.


Tekan ENTER untuk melanjutkan proses installasi.
Tahapan selanjutnya muncul tampilan Keyboard Type, pilih us, pilih OK.
Tahapan selanjutnya muncul tampilan Time Zone Selection,
pilih System clock uses UTC, pilih Asia/Jakarta, pilih OK.
Tahapan selanjutnya muncul tampilan Root Password, masukan
password root, misal ”password”, pilih OK.
Tahapan selanjutnya muncul tampilan Package Installation,tunggu
beberapa menit(tergantung spesifikasi komputer) hingga selesai sampai
reboot sendiri.
Setelah proses installasi selesai, maka tahapan selanjutnya muncul tampilan Welcome to Trixbox CE.
Silahkan login menggunakan user: root , dan password root yang tadi telah di buat yaitu: password.
Trixbox sendiri secara default menggunakan sistem dhcp. jadi ketika trixbox yang anda install tidak ada
ip addressnya seperti pada gambar gak perlu khawatir, tinggal setting ip address trixbox secara manual.
Jika trixbox anda sudah mendapatkan ip address secara dhcp (otomatis) dari router pada jaringan anda
tinggal lanjut pada ketahapan selanjutnya yaitu konfigurasi trixbox…
Setelah login pada sistem trixbox, kemudian ketik perintah system-
config-network untuk mengkonfigurasi ip address. Setelah itu bakan
muncul tampilan seperti berikut: pilih Edit Device, tekan Enter.
Tahapan selanjutnya muncul tampilan Select A Device, pilih device yang
ada eth0 (eth0), tekan Enter. awas jangn di save dulu ya.
Tahapan selanjutnya muncul tampilan Devernet Configuration. Sesuaikan ip address
dengan jaringan anda. pilih OK.
ip address : 10.5.5.130
netmask : 255.255.252.0
gateway : 10.5.5.130
Tahapan selanjutnya pada Select A Device kemudian pilih Save aja.
Tahapan selanjutnya pada Select Action, pilih Edit DNS
Configuration,tekan Enter.
Tahapan selanjutnya muncul tampilan DNS Configuration, masukan ip
dns dan hostname trixbox, pilih OK.
Tahapan selanjutnya pada Select Action, pilih Save&Quit. Setelah itu
reboot/restart trixbox.
Tahapan installasi Server Trixbox sudah selesai dan siap untuk
dikonfigurasi lewat webconfig.
TAHAPAN KONFIGURASI SERVER TRIXBOX
Konfigurasi server Trixbox lewat web browser pengguna dengan memasukan ip
address trixbox pada address bar browser. Kemudian pilih User mode
[switch] untuk masuk ke mode administrator trixbox.

Trixbox- Webconfig
Masukan username: maint dan password: password. Pilih Log In.

Trixbox- Login
Setelah berhasil login kedalam mode administrator, Kemudian
setting/tambahkan extension (nomor telpon yang bisa diguakan oleh
client/pengguna). Pilih PBX >> PBX Settings >> Extensions >> Device:
Generic SIP Device >> Submit.
Tahapan selanjutnya muncul tampilan Add SIP Extension, masukan (sesuai yang diinginkan) :
User Extension  : 1022 (nomor telpon)
Display Name  : Kantor Administrasi  (Nama register)
Secret  : 123abc (password)
Status voicemail : Enable
Voicemail password : 1022
VmX Locater : Enable
Use When : unavailable , busy , standard voicemail prompts.
Pilih Submit >> Apply Configuration Changes.
Tahapan selanjutnya pada tampilan Apply Configuration
Changes, pilih Continue with reload.
Berikut contoh Extersion yang sudah admin buat.
TAHAPAN KONFIGURASI VOIP CLIENT (DESKTOP)

Tambahkan account pada aplikasi X-Lite, pilih Settings >> SIP Account Settings..


Masukan user extension yang sudah di buat pada server trixbox
beserta password extension dan alamat ip address trixbox.
X-Lite sudah dikonfigurasi dan siap digunakan untuk menelpon sesama
extension yang ada pada server trixbox, bila sudah muncul keterangan
“Ready” pada layar softphone X-Lite.
UJI COBA PANGGILAN SERVER VoIP MENGGUNAKAN
SOFTPHONE X-LITE

Uji coba panggilan suara dari “Kantor TKJ” ke “kantor Administrasi” Berhasil
UJI COBA PANGGILAN SERVER VoIP MENGGUNAKAN
SOFTPHONE X-LITE

Uji coba panggilan suara dari “kantor Administrasi” ke “Kantor TKJ” Berhasil
Selesai….
Selamat Mencoba….

Terima Kasih

Jika ingin melihat tutorial versi video silahakn klik link dibawah:

https://drive.google.com/file/d/1en5KhwPT1jo_MF8Yegzn1PJ_yMMQTd4V/view?
usp=sharing

Anda mungkin juga menyukai